North Dorset Travel takes a B8R Plaxton Panther

Ex-demonstrator Volvo B8R Plaxton Panther now with North Dorset Travel

Holton Heath, Poole operator North Dorset Travel has added an ex-demonstrator Volvo B8R with Panther bodywork to its fleet, supplied by Plaxton (01909 551166).

The 12.8m, 53-seat coach has a toilet and servery, a reversing camera, a DVD player, three-point belts and USB charging points at every seat and the Panther’s reputation and flexibility were among other attributes that appealed, says MD Richard Green.

“We pride ourselves on running a fleet of high-specification coaches that enhance the passenger experience and encourage repeat business.

“That strategy has proved to be a winner for the best part of a century and the Panther will further endorse our credentials as a business that goes the extra mile in terms of providing style, comfort and tailor-made solutions.”
